A Comprehensive Guide to Casement Window Replacement
Casement windows are a popular choice among house owners due to their special performance and aesthetic appeal. With hinges found on one side, these windows open outward, offering exceptional ventilation and an unobstructed view. However, like all home parts, they may ultimately need replacement. This article provides a thorough guide to changing casement windows, including crucial considerations, steps to follow, and FAQs.
Why Replace Casement Windows?
Before diving into the replacement procedure, it's crucial to understand why homeowners may select to change casement windows:
Energy Efficiency: Older windows might have lost their insulation residential or commercial properties, causing increased energy expenses.Aesthetic Updates: Homeowners might want to improve the exterior appearance of their homes.Performance Issues: Worn-out or broken windows may be hard to open or seal correctly.Noise Reduction: Newer models typically supply much better sound insulation, improving indoor convenience.When to Replace Casement Windows
Identifying the ideal time for a casement window replacement is important. Here are some signs that show a requirement for replacement:
Visible Damage: Look for cracks, chips, or warping in the window frame.Drafts: Noticeable drafts when the windows are closed signal that the seals may be jeopardized.Condensation: Presence of water in between the panes indicates failed double glazing.Problem in Operation: If windows end up being tough to open or close, it might be time for replacements.Picking the Right Casement Windows
When selecting new casement windows, think about the following factors:

Material:
Vinyl: Low maintenance, excellent insulation.Wood: Classic look however needs more upkeep.Aluminum: Durable however might not be as energy-efficient.
Energy Efficiency Ratings: Look for Energy Star-certified windows to make sure lower energy costs.

Design and Customization: Choose a style that complements your home's architecture, with choices for color, size, and grid patterns.

Changing casement windows can be a large task. Here's a step-by-step guide to assist house owners:
Step 1: Measure the Opening
Precise measurements are essential. Utilize a tape procedure to identify the width and height of the window opening. Measure at multiple indicate guarantee harmony, as old frames might not be perfectly square.
Step 2: Remove the Old WindowPrepare the Area: Clear the surrounding area of furnishings or decors.Remove Window Stops: Gently pry off the stops holding the window in location.Secure the Old Window: Remove the window frame thoroughly, ensuring not to harm the surrounding wall or trim.Action 3: Install New WindowsCheck the Opening: Clean and prepare the opening for the new window.Place the New Window: Center the new casement window in the opening, ensuring it is level.Secure the Window: Fasten it according to the maker's instructions, generally with screws.Seal the Edges: Use caulk to seal the edges and avoid air and water leaks.Step 4: Finishing TouchesReattach Stops: Replace the window stops to protect the window in place.Touch Up Paint: If necessary, paint or complete the trim around the window to match the decoration.Step 5: Clean Up
Eliminate any debris from the installation procedure and look for any problems. Ensure that the window opens and closes efficiently.
FAQs about Casement Window ReplacementWhat is the typical cost of casement window replacement?
The cost might vary widely based upon window type, products, and labor. Usually, homeowners can anticipate to invest in between ₤ 300 to ₤ 800 per window, consisting of installation.
For how long does it take to change casement windows?
The replacement procedure for a single window usually takes in between 2 to 4 hours, while several windows might need an entire day or more, depending upon the degree of work needed.
Can I change casement windows myself?
While DIY replacement is possible, it requires accurate measurements, tools, and skills. Employing a professional might guarantee a higher quality of installation.
What maintenance is needed after installation?
New casement windows require minimal maintenance. Routine cleaning of the glass and lubrication of the hinges will make sure long-lasting efficiency. Examine seals occasionally and tidy window tracks.
Are casement windows an excellent choice for energy performance?
Yes, casement windows are understood for their energy efficiency, especially when correctly sealed and set up. They use outstanding ventilation without sacrificing thermal efficiency.
